Working with Equipotential Update Mode

SOLIDWORKS Electrical automatically updates the electrical project database and the graphics of the drawings as you work. With large projects however, this involves a large number of calculations, which can cause delays. You can activate Deferred mode to disable automatic project and drawing updates and save time.

Activate and Deactivate Deferred Update Mode

You can activate Deferred mode to disable calculating equipotential updates automatically when you manipulate wires. Using a feature that needs the equipotential information, such as wire cabling order, or exports, enables automatic updating while the feature is running.

  1. To activate Deferred mode, click Process > Activate .
    When Deferred mode is active, wire and equipotential numbers are not displayed, and equipotential conflicts are not detected.
    • The Activate icon is highlighted.
    • Automatic updating is disabled.
  2. To deactivate Deferred mode, click Activate .
    • The Activate icon highlight is removed.
    • Automatic updating is enabled.

Update Equipotential Calculations Manually

You can update equipotential calculations manually.
  1. To update the equipotentials, click Process > Update connections .
    Update connections is nonly available when Deferred mode is active.
